Rated 5.0 out of 5.0 by Happy Christmas Booked between Xmas eve and the day after Boxing day. We requested 2 rooms close to each other in the other requirements and were allocated adjoining rooms which really made our booking special as we could relax and celebrate as one big family. The service on Xmas eve was exceptional, we arrived after dinner but were made to feel comfortable in the bar area where we ordered dinner from a wide ranging menu. The food was delicious all trip and exceptions to the menu were no trouble. The breakfasts each morning were again tremendous and our large group were easily accommodated together. The bar staff all trip were friendly and keen to cater to our tastes. The hotel rooms were large and comfortable, and spotlessly clean. The pool and sauna had long opening times and were not restricted on Xmas day which was a bonus as we have stayed elsewhere and not had limited facilities at Xmas. We stay away every Xmas and based on experience this hotel was as good, probably better than previous hotels. Most importantly the children loved it, and they say children never lie! I would fully recommend this hotel if you are looking for a comfortable relaxing stay. The staff are down to earth and hard working. The hotel is well located if you have a car, otherwise public transport is sparse. We did venture to the local pub which is a few minutes walk, The Moor House, which is a lively but friendly place, not for kids though. There is also an Indian restaurant, Burger King and a service station for essentials within a few minutes walk. All in all a fantastic experience and a very happy Xmas was had by all. January 4, 2013

Rated 3.0 out of 5.0 by Decent rooms at a decent price, but work to do The standard of this hotel has been improving over the years that we have stayed there. Reception seems to have been pretty well sorted; the TV system in the rooms is much better; housekeeping staff are both efficient and friendly. The quality of breakfasts leaves much to be desired. In part, this may be due to the Holiday Inn franchise requirements, but cooked breakfast does not keep well on steam baths - hard bacon, sausages swimming in fat, solid, crusty eggs - and is not complemented by awful machine-made coffee and fruit juice that tastes synthetic. This is shouting out for improvement: a good start would be to have a staff member circulating round the restaurant area checking that everything is fine - that the food is looking good and that empty containers are refilled promptly. The most recent bar food menu is better, but the offerings could be better prepared and presented. All that said, this hotel is good value if you book ahead (but not if you have to pay the rack rate). It just needs smartening up. December 11, 2012
